  <bioghist id="aspace_4d970fa7202635cf7ff02abc9e040f03">
    <head>Biographical / Historical</head>
<p>"The first Naval Chaplain School was created in February 1942 when civilian clergy, the majority of whom had no prior military experience, entered the Navy to serve during World War II.[8] The school began at Naval Station Norfolk, Norfolk, Virginia, later moving to the campus of the College of William and Mary, in Williamsburg, Virginia, until its decommissioning 15 November 1945." (Source: "Armed Forces Chaplaincy Center," https://en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Armed_Forces_Chaplaincy_Center, retrieved 2025 October 25)</p>  </bioghist>
